diff mbox series

[-next] x86/xen: Convert to DEFINE_SHOW_ATTRIBUTE

Message ID 20200716090641.14184-1-miaoqinglang@huawei.com (mailing list archive)
State Superseded
Headers show
Series [-next] x86/xen: Convert to DEFINE_SHOW_ATTRIBUTE | expand

Commit Message

Qinglang Miao July 16, 2020, 9:06 a.m. UTC
From: Chen Huang <chenhuang5@huawei.com>

Use DEFINE_SHOW_ATTRIBUTE macro to simplify the code.

Signed-off-by: Chen Huang <chenhuang5@huawei.com>
---
 arch/x86/xen/p2m.c | 12 +-----------
 1 file changed, 1 insertion(+), 11 deletions(-)

Comments

Boris Ostrovsky July 19, 2020, 1:59 a.m. UTC | #1
On 7/16/20 5:06 AM, Qinglang Miao wrote:
> From: Chen Huang <chenhuang5@huawei.com>
>
> Use DEFINE_SHOW_ATTRIBUTE macro to simplify the code.
>
> Signed-off-by: Chen Huang <chenhuang5@huawei.com>


Reviewed-by: Boris Ostrovsky <boris.ostrovsky@oracle.com>
Qinglang Miao Sept. 17, 2020, 12:54 p.m. UTC | #2
在 2020/7/19 9:59, Boris Ostrovsky 写道:
> On 7/16/20 5:06 AM, Qinglang Miao wrote:
>> From: Chen Huang <chenhuang5@huawei.com>
>>
>> Use DEFINE_SHOW_ATTRIBUTE macro to simplify the code.
>>
>> Signed-off-by: Chen Huang <chenhuang5@huawei.com>
> 
> 
> Reviewed-by: Boris Ostrovsky <boris.ostrovsky@oracle.com>
> 
> 
Hi Boris,

I noticed that this patch has been rebiewed but there's small conflict 
if you apply it against latest linux-next. So I resend a v2 patch 
against linux-next(20200917), and it can be applied to mainline cleanly 
now.

Thanks.
diff mbox series

Patch

diff --git a/arch/x86/xen/p2m.c b/arch/x86/xen/p2m.c
index 4cf680e2e..0f4a449de 100644
--- a/arch/x86/xen/p2m.c
+++ b/arch/x86/xen/p2m.c
@@ -799,17 +799,7 @@  static int p2m_dump_show(struct seq_file *m, void *v)
 	return 0;
 }
 
-static int p2m_dump_open(struct inode *inode, struct file *filp)
-{
-	return single_open(filp, p2m_dump_show, NULL);
-}
-
-static const struct file_operations p2m_dump_fops = {
-	.open		= p2m_dump_open,
-	.read_iter		= seq_read_iter,
-	.llseek		= seq_lseek,
-	.release	= single_release,
-};
+DEFINE_SHOW_ATTRIBUTE(p2m_dump);
 
 static struct dentry *d_mmu_debug;